One of those moves involved trading relief pitcher Brennan Bernardino to the Colorado Rockies for minor leaguer Braiden Ward in November. It was a somewhat surprising move at the time considering that Bernardino had been one of the Red Sox's steadiest and most reliable relievers over the previous three seasons, helping them make the playoffs in 2025. Perhaps motivated by his age (34) and declining strikeout rate, Boston decided to move on.
Sports reporter Tyler Boronski recently interviewed the veteran reliever about the trade and adjusting to his new team. "It's been great. I've learned a lot since I got here.
Been trying to hone in on some of my skills and I'm excited to put in use what I learned in spring training," Bernardino said. “In this game anything is possible…I wouldn’t say I was surprised. ” MLB reliever Brennan Bernardino on being traded from the Boston Red Sox to the Colorado Rockies this offseason.
